Density Matrices and Geometric Phases for n-state Systems

Abstract
An explicit parameterization is given for the density matrices for -state systems. The geometry of the space of pure and mixed states and the entropy of the -state system is discussed. Geometric phases can arise in only specific subspaces of the space of all density matrices. The possibility of obtaining nontrivial abelian and nonabelian geometric phases in these subspaces is discussed.
